Perfect Indoor Photos Every Time: Simple Lighting Secrets That Work
Transform your indoor photography from dim and dull to studio-quality with just three essential lighting principles. Position your main light source at a 45-degree angle to your subject, creating depth and dimension while minimizing harsh shadows. Master the fundamentals of light diffusion by bouncing flash off white walls or using simple household items like white sheets as makeshift softboxes. Control your camera’s exposure settings to balance artificial lighting with any available natural light, starting with an ISO of 400 and adjusting your aperture to f/4 for that professional depth-of-field effect.
